Am I considered a repeater? 

You are a repeater if you have fully completed the Art of Meditation (Sahaj Samadhi) course before. If you have only completed the Happiness Course but not the Art of Meditation (Sahaj Samadhi) course, then you are not considered a repeater for this course.

Most forms of meditation help you relax the mind.


Sahaj Samadhi takes you deeper.

“Sahaj Samadhi taught me not just to relax, but to access a deep inner stillness I didn’t know was possible.” — Dr Jennifer Irwin, Psychiatrist

Using a simple, personalised mantra, the mind is allowed to settle and then transcend - moving beyond thought, beyond effort, and into a state of deep rest and awareness.

This is not concentration or control. It’s a natural process where the mind effortlessly drops into stillness.


Why this meditation is different

  • No concentration or control required

  • No need to “clear the mind” or be free from thoughts

  • Effortless and easy to practise

  • Takes you beyond relaxation into transcendence

While many techniques keep you at the level of the thinking mind, Sahaj Samadhi allows access to a deeper layer of consciousness - a state of quiet alertness and inner fullness.
